Europe is Leading the World in the Growth of BVLOS Drone Services Via Cellular

This article highlights the three most important developments for the European drone market; European Commission (EU) Drone Strategy 2.0; Electronic Communication Committee Decision; U-space Regulatory Package introducing Remote ID.

The EU Drone Strategy 2:0: recognises the Aerial Connectivity Joint Activity (ACJA) as a critical contributor to developing the continents drone services market.
